What inspired us is how crash detection is only available high end cars or expensive devices such as the iPhone 14, we believe that we can change that.

The Whistle can automatically detect an accident and send an emergency signal for first responders to find you. The entire process is automated and takes milliseconds.

We built the product based on the Lora Module that is able to send info to the internet over long distances and a radius of 10km. We plan to build our own network that covers the entirety of North America.

The main challenge that we ran to is the ability to send an SOS signal from an online server to the telephone line of 911. Currently, no city has an online emergency contact that's why we had to find another solution. We decided to partner with Bandwidth to allow us to use their API. Their API is specially designed to send a 911 call to request aid.

We learned many different concepts in communication and data management that allowed us to come up and manage this idea.

The next step is to expand our Lora network to provide coverage to a large area.
